Abstract
The invention discloses a precision glue spreading control system for a glue spreader, which comprises a programmable logic controller (PLC) control system, a thickness measuring system and an actuating mechanism, wherein the PLC control system is connected with the actuating mechanism through a data processing (DP) bus; the thickness measuring system is connected with the PLC control system and the actuating mechanism through a switching value and an analogue value; the actuating mechanism comprises a first metering roller, a second metering roller, a spreading roller, a rubber roller, a cooling roller and a traction roller; the spreading roller is arranged between the first metering roller and the second metering roller; the rubber roller is arranged at the lower end of the spreading roller; and the cooling roller and the traction roller are arranged on two sides of the rubber roller. The precision glue spreading control system for the glue spreader solves a problem of tension between a traction motor and the rubber roller, a problem of speed difference between the spreading roller and the rubber roller and a problem of roller distance between the metering rollers and the spreading roller, detects the quality of products in real time through the thickness measuring system, and sends a signal to regulate the glue spreading speed when the quality exceeds the set allowable range so as to ensure the quality of the products.

As Fig. 1, Fig. 2 and shown in Figure 3, the accurate gluing control system of glue spreader of the present invention, comprise the PLC control system, thickness measuring system and executing agency, the PLC control system is connected by the DP bus with executing agency, thickness measuring system is connected with executing agency with the PLC control system with analog quantity by switching value, executing agency comprises metering one roller 1, measure two rollers 3, glue spreader 2, rubber rollers 4, chill roll 5 and carry-over pinch rolls 6, glue spreader 2 is installed in metering one roller 1 and measures between two rollers 3, rubber rollers 4 is installed in glue spreader 2 lower ends, chill roll 5 and carry-over pinch rolls 6 are installed in the both sides of rubber rollers 4 respectively, the PLC control system comprises roll adjustment control, logic control system and driving control system, driving control system comprises the carry-over pinch rolls drive motors, measure a roll drive motor, measure two roll drive motors, the glue spreader drive motors, rubber rollers drive motors and chill roll drive motors, be provided with tension pick-up between glue spreader and the carry-over pinch rolls, the course of work of the accurate gluing control system of glue spreader is: first-selection, by the given thickness measuring benchmark of PLC control system, signal is transported in the thickness measuring system, then, thickness measuring system detects the actual (real) thickness of goods, again should detected actual (real) thickness signal feedback in the PLC control system, calculate the thickness difference of goods by the PLC control system, by the PLC control system this thickness difference signal is flowed to executing agency again, adjust by executing agency.
This system at first wants the depth of parallelism between gluing roller that machinery guarantees and traction roller and the parallel of horizontal plane and two rollers, between glue spreader and carry-over pinch rolls, there is high-precision tension pick-up to detect the tension force of paper, the actual tension of Dpv paper, in the upper system of PLC control system, provide the tension force of the paper of technological requirement, the setting tension force of DSV paper, these two values (Dpv and Dsv) are as a kind of algorithm in the PID(logic control system) setting value and actual value in the control algolithm, requirement obtains an output valve Dcv behind the pid algorithm obtains traction electric machine then by formula once speed set-point, Dspeed_set=Dmain_speed (1+X*Dcv/Y), X is the percentage of main frame speed, and Y is the maximum of PID output; In whole system complementary seeing of can not isolating, mainly be that coating in release liners is liquid material, because loaded material between metering roll and the glue spreader, so require the roll spacing precision between metering roll and the glue spreader very high, manufacturing technique requirent reaches 0.001mm, except machinery exigent precision in processing, electric mainly be the precision of the rotation of requirement control roll adjustment motor, so know that in this system we adopt servo-control system, make the running accuracy of motor reach branch and precision, more can influence the quality of release liners under comparing, because glue spreader speed difference the quality of material on release liners different with rubber rollers is different, and when moving in system because the influence of the temperature of environment and other some unknown factors all can have influence on quality of material on the release liners, in this case we just need a closed-loop system come at every moment the glue spreader of adjusting and the speed difference between the rubber rollers, guarantee to produce high-precision goods, thickness measuring system detection Products Quality at every moment by NDC, when surpassing the allowed band of setting, adjust the speed of gluing to signal, thereby guarantee Products Quality.
